What is a Vanuatu solar PV system?

This project is aligned to the Government of Vanuatu’s National Energy Road Map for increasing the energy access for rural communities in Vanuatu. The installed solar PV system is a stand-alone 230/400 VAC 50Hz solar micro-grid combined with 48V batteries operating 24 hours and 7 days a week.

What is Vanuatu's New solar farm?

Set to be constructed by the Vanuatu Electricity Authority (VEA) in collaboration with the Asian Development Bank (ADB) and the European Union (EU), this solar farm boasts a capacity of 5 megawatts. Upon completion, it is expected to produce 7,500 megawatt-hours of electricity annually, enough to power around 2,000 local homes.

Solar station to power desalination in Vanuatu

A containerised solar power system, dubbed the ''Solar Station'', has arrived in Vanuatu as the first of a series designed to power fresh water production for 11,000 people on the islands. Developed by SolarCity NZ for Hitachi, the 50 kWp solar power system has been built within a modified shipping container and will power the first of two ...

Solar Photovoltaic Technology Basics

What is photovoltaic (PV) technology and how does it work? PV materials and devices convert sunlight into electrical energy. A single PV device is known as a cell. An individual PV cell is usually small, typically producing about 1 or 2 watts of power. These cells are made of different semiconductor materials and are often less than the thickness of four human hairs.

Grid integration assessment

PV = photovoltaic POWER SYSTEM CONDITIONS (2016) The power system of the Luganville grid on Espiritu Santo comprises one 600 kW and two 300 kW hydropower plants. Vanuatu Utilities and Infrastructure (VUI) has indicated that 40 kW of solar PV has been in place within the power system as of 2016. The remaining demand is supplied by

Vanuatu

In Vanuatu, the annual energy production from solar photovoltaic (PV) systems varies by location and seasonal factors. According to the International Renewable Energy Agency (IRENA), the country exhibits a range of solar resource potentials, with annual PV output per unit of capacity spanning from less than 1,200 kWh/kWp to over 1,600 kWh/kWp. 2

Solar power generation by PV (photovoltaic) technology: A review

The efficiency of energy conversion depends mainly on the PV panels that generate power. The practical systems have low overall efficiency. This is the result of the cascaded product of several efficiencies, as the energy is converted from the sun through the PV array, the regulators, the battery, cabling and through an inverter to supply the ac load [10], [11].
